To add on to this point, Yale’s endowment is 43 billion. Harvard’s is 53 billion. University of Texas is 42 billion.

So yes, Howard’s endowment is large relative to other HBCUs but minuscule compared to others. Also, that 700 million endowment is not like money that can be entirely used at once or within a short time frame. So these issues aren’t entirely solvable with the endowment. Additionally, Howard doesn’t have the same level of resources that some other (read: PWI) schools have to manage the fund. Yale’s endowment fund management is literally taught in business schools because it’s so well managed. Howard is nowhere near that level.
